Jacquees, real name Rodriquez Jacquees Broadex, is an American singer and record producer born in Decatur, Georgia. Active since 2011, he has gained recognition for his distinctive vocal style that blends contemporary R and B with influences from hip-hop and trap. Among his most popular tracks are "B.E.D.", "You", and "At The Club". In 2016, he released his debut album "4275", followed by "King of R and B" in 2018, which brought him wider recognition in the American music scene. Jacquees is known for his collaborations with artists such as Birdman, Chris Brown, and Usher. His smooth and melodic vocal style, along with his ability to create romantic and sensual atmospheres, have made him one of the most representative figures in contemporary R and B.
